## Ownership

Rate limiting in the Thorngate gateway lives in the `limits/` module. Token buckets are configured per upstream service; do not edit the generated quota files by hand. Changes require a review plus a dry run against the staging mesh. If a client reports spurious 429s, check the clock-skew guard before touching bucket sizes. Contractors have read access only; limit overrides need sign-off. All rate-limiting changes, incidents, and quota requests route through the single owner named below.

named custodian: Brivan Eliath Quenox Frador

## Dependency Pinning Policy — Orchard Build System

All dependencies in the Orchard toolchain must be pinned to exact versions with recorded checksums; ranges are not permitted in release branches. When updating a pin, run the provenance audit so the lockfile, the mirror snapshot at Dunmere, and the build manifest all agree. New contractors should never hand-edit lockfiles — use the pin tool, which records who changed what and why. Every audited lockfile is sealed with the token below.

pipeline stamp: htk31_f769b577b3028a4e9958e5bb8d1259a

### Catalog cache gone stale? Start here.

When a customer says Pinwheel Goods shows old prices, it's almost always the catalog cache. Kick off an invalidation from the support console — it purges the affected SKUs within a minute or two. Don't flush the whole cache unless at least ten items are wrong. The console's recovery login, used when normal SSO is down, asks for the recovery passphrase below.

recovery phrase for fajep-yaweg: gilath-sorox-wenius-rusdor-keliel-zorius